Introduction

The Edible Insects Market refers to the global industry involved in the farming, processing, and commercialization of insects for human consumption. Insects are recognized as a high-protein, nutrient-dense, and sustainable food source, making them an emerging category in the alternative protein landscape. This market has gained global attention due to increasing demand for sustainable food solutions, growing awareness of protein shortages, and rising interest in environmentally friendly dietary patterns.

The market holds strong relevance as climate concerns and resource limitations reshape global food systems. Edible insects require significantly less land, water, and feed compared to traditional livestock, making them a resource-efficient protein option. The Evolution

The rise of the Edible Insects Market began with traditional consumption patterns in Asia, Africa, and Latin America, where insects have been part of local diets for centuries. The modern commercial market grew as global sustainability studies highlighted the environmental benefits of insect-based protein. Reports from scientific bodies emphasized insects as a solution to the expected global protein shortage, encouraging food companies and investors to explore edible insect production.

Key milestones include advancements in automated insect farming, the development of insect-based protein powders, and the launch of ready-to-eat insect snacks. Innovations also emerged in processing technologies that improve flavor, safety, and shelf life. Research-driven improvements led to stable supply chains and increased industrial-scale production.

Shifts in demand were influenced by growing consumer interest in plant-based and alternative proteins, rising awareness of greenhouse gas emissions linked to livestock, and the expansion of fitness and nutrition markets. These shifts positioned edible insects as a competitive protein source for future food systems.

Market Trends

Several trends define the Edible Insects Market:

Growth of high-protein diets. Fitness-conscious consumers and athletes are adopting insect-based protein powders due to their essential amino acid content and digestibility.

Introduction of insect-based packaged foods. Companies are producing insect snacks, bars, pasta, and baked products targeting mainstream consumers.

Expansion of insect farming technology. Vertical insect farms, automated feeding systems, and AI-driven climate control are improving yield and reducing production costs.

Increased global attention to sustainability. Consumers are choosing environmentally friendly foods, increasing edible insect adoption in North America and Europe.

Commercial interest from food and beverage companies. Large food producers are investing in insect protein research and partnerships.

Use of edible insects in pet food and aquaculture. Cross-industry use boosts production efficiency and reduces dependence on fishmeal and soy.

Regulatory frameworks emerging worldwide. Governments are developing food safety standards for insect farming and processing, supporting market stability.

Challenges

Despite growth opportunities, the Edible Insects Market faces several challenges:

Consumer reluctance. Cultural perceptions and unfamiliarity with insect-based food products reduce adoption in certain markets.

Regulatory uncertainty. Many countries are still developing safety guidelines, slowing commercialization.

Supply chain limitations. Large-scale production requires specialized infrastructure, which increases initial investment.

Cost competitiveness. Insect proteins remain more expensive than conventional protein sources in some regions.

Limited awareness. Consumers often lack knowledge about the nutritional profile and sustainability benefits of edible insects.

Production risks. Insect farming involves complex climate control and disease prevention requirements, creating operational challenges.

FAQ

What are edible insects?
Edible insects are insect species processed or prepared for human consumption, offering high protein levels and sustainable production benefits.

Why are edible insects considered sustainable?
They require less land, water, and feed than traditional livestock and produce lower greenhouse gas emissions.

What insect species are commonly used in food products?
Crickets, mealworms, beetles, grasshoppers, and black soldier fly larvae are the most commercially used species.

Are edible insects safe to consume?
When produced under regulated farming and processing conditions, edible insects are safe and meet food safety standards.

Which regions lead the edible insect market?
Asia-Pacific leads due to traditional consumption patterns, while Europe and North America are expanding rapidly.

How are insects used in food?
They are used whole, ground into powder, or processed into bars, snacks, pasta, and functional foods.

What drives the growth of the edible insects market?
Sustainability needs, health benefits, technological advancements, and rising demand for alternative proteins.
